Key Insights
The North American residential construction market, valued at $850 million in 2025, is projected to experience steady growth, driven by several key factors. A robust increase in population, particularly in urban areas, coupled with favorable government policies supporting affordable housing initiatives and infrastructure development, fuels demand for new housing units. The rising disposable incomes and increasing urbanization across the US, Canada, and Mexico contribute significantly to this growth. Furthermore, the ongoing shift towards sustainable and energy-efficient construction practices presents lucrative opportunities for companies focusing on green building technologies. While rising material costs and labor shortages pose challenges, the overall market outlook remains positive, with a projected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 4.5% from 2025 to 2033. The multi-family segment, driven by the increasing preference for rental housing, particularly among millennials and Gen Z, is expected to witness faster growth compared to the single-family segment. New construction will dominate the market, although renovation activities will also contribute significantly, particularly in established urban areas with aging housing stock. Major players such as Lennar Corporation, D.R. Horton, and PulteGroup are well-positioned to capitalize on these trends, although intense competition and fluctuating interest rates will continue to shape the market dynamics.
The geographical distribution of growth is expected to be uneven. While the United States will remain the dominant market, Canada and Mexico will witness substantial growth due to economic expansion and urbanization in key metropolitan areas. Obstacles in the North America Residential Construction Market
The market faces challenges including supply chain disruptions, material cost fluctuations, skilled labor shortages, and stringent building regulations that can delay projects and increase costs. These factors, along with increasing land prices and fluctuating interest rates, can impact market growth and profitability. Key Developments in North America Residential Construction Market Industry
- December 2022: D.R. Horton plans USD 215 Million residential development in southeast Columbus.
- December 2022: Lennar Corp. cancels plans to spin off its multifamily subsidiary due to market conditions.
- December 2022: Pulte Homes acquires a 17-acre site in Fort Myers, Florida, for USD 2.4 Million to develop a 52-home community (Addison Square).
